Reviews:
"João Madeira is back on his new label 4DaRecord
with a wonderful duo with Paolo Galão. The music is
mostly free improvised, but there are free jazz sounding
parts. The spirits remind me, of course, of some
recordings of Evan Parker, John Butcher or even Ken
Vandermark with various bass players: Barry Guy, Rafal
Mazur and more. But, at the very end this is a very original
music and very diverse, combining various styles and
moods. The duo plays six medim length tracks, starting
from "Ostras", reminding me of Evan Parker, indeed.
One of my favorites is the 8 minutes long "Belarmino",
a little in the Ken Vandermark style. The title track,
"Ângula Flama", is a peaceful and beautiful free ballad
with phenomenal bowing parts from the double bass. I
adore also the closing "For Example", starting with an
amazing bass solo, combining nger-picking and bowing,
with a very peaceful, hymn like phrases of Paolo Galão
on tenor. Top class stuff!!!" Maciej Lewenstein

"João Madeira on double bass and multi-instrumentalist Paulo Galão on saxophones and clarinets are the protagonists of this recording, made in their own home studios during the quarantine due to the pandemic in 2020. Given the impossibility of meeting, the two exchanged short improvisations, reacting to the sounds of the other in an unusual dialogue which then took shape during the mixing up to the physical CD. It is a dense, intense dialogue, which is linked to what is the impro scene in Europe, to musicians like Evan Parker or Barry Guy. Everything flows in a calm and free way, the double bass is played both with the bow and in pizzicato, on the other hand the saxophones and the Galão clarinets emanate a warm sound that gives the whole session, a forty minute, something of harvest, intimistic." Vittorio / Musiczoom

"Singular chamber music for double bass and sax or clarinet recorded for the first issue of the 4DA Records catalogue. Double bass player João Madeira is a pillar of the important Portuguese improvised scene, close to Ernesto and Guilherme Rodrigues, Jose Oliveira, Hernani Faustino, Miguel Mira, etc. Paulo Galão has a smooth sound and a lively articulation on the clarinet, with a preference for a muffled and melodic free play, all in nuances, and a precious and light breath on the saxophone. The duettists offer us six improvisations of average length between 6 and 8 minutes in which they skilfully circumvent the lines and curves of each of them, each following their own path while completing each other on the tape in ellipses and tangents. Their music oscillates, sways (Palavras sem Boca) or creeps to the edge of silence (Morder Bruma), transforming itself from one improvisation to the next. They have chosen the softness of pale mornings and late afternoons when you contemplate the sun's rays shaving the foliage of the bushes. Freshness, spontaneity, prettiness or beauty. Poetry of the unspeakable. The bow is maintained and operated with masterly hands by an inspired Madeira and his pizzicato has a beautiful power that makes the soul of the large violin vibrate. Belarmino is the beautiful piece where Galão, secret and thrilling, opens up his heart to us on the clarinet. Ângulo Flama, which gives its title to the album, gives a cadence to the double bass with a superb dose of harmonics, its share of mystery and some notes held by the blower. This is a beautiful album to listen to for the pleasure of contemplating a well-made work that comes from the heart. As I said above about Brecht, the Portuguese scene has a lot to offer to those who are willing to follow their releases on these inspired micro-labels and the inevitable Creative Sources and Clean Feed." Jean-Michel Van Schouwburg,
orynx-improvandsounds.blogspot
